In modern industrial and commercial building design, mechanical HVAC systems are subject to continuous operation under harsh meteorological conditions. Condensate piping, which extracts liquid byproduct from air handlers and cooling coils, is especially prone to extreme temperature variations. When cold condensate runs through pipelines exposed to high ambient humidity and solar radiation, condensation forms rapidly on the exterior surface. Without high-specification, waterproof insulation, this condensation initiates a cycle of thermal degradation, mold growth, structural damage, and Corrosion Under Insulation (CUI).

Water has a thermal conductivity ($\lambda$) of approximately 0.6 W/(m·K) at room temperature, which is more than 17 times higher than that of dry air trapped within an insulation matrix. For every 1% increase in moisture content by volume within an insulation material, its thermal conductivity can increase by up to 15%. A non-waterproofed or open-cell insulation material exposed to external humidity will quickly saturate, leading to total thermal failure and substantial energy loss.

Large-scale commercial high-rises and centralized district cooling plants require insulation systems that can withstand decades of constant operation under high temperature and humidity. Condensation on chilled water supply and return lines can quickly ruin interior ceilings and drywalls. Kingflex closed-cell rubber foam ensures that thermal efficiency remains constant, eliminating condensation hazards while maintaining low energy footprints across HVAC cycles.


For petrochemical plants, LNG storage terminals, and ultra-low temperature cryogenic process pipes, standard insulating materials will quickly crack and freeze. Kingflex Flexible Elastomeric Cryogenic Insulation is specially formulated to retain its mechanical flexibility at temperatures down to -200°C. Its high elasticity absorbs thermal shocks and contractions, maintaining structural integrity under extreme thermal gradients.

Technical specifications, standard dimensions, and customization options for wholesale buyers.
To assist mechanical engineering contractors, procurement managers, and wholesale distributors, we maintain strict dimensional standards for our elastomeric rubber foam lines. Customized lengths, thicknesses, self-adhesive backings, and exterior protective foils (such as aluminum cladding or UV-resistant films) are available upon request.
| Property / Dimension | Standard Specification Range |
|---|---|
| Base Material Blend | Premium NBR (Nitrile Butadiene Rubber) / PVC compound matrix |
| Available Thicknesses | 6mm, 9mm, 13mm, 16mm, 19mm, 25mm, 32mm, 40mm, 50mm |
| Apparent Density | 40 - 55 kg/m³ (regulated for optimum thermal-mechanical balance) |
| Service Temperature Range | -40℃ to +105℃ (limits vary based on specialized cryogenic compound settings) |
| Water Vapor Resistance Factor ($\mu$) | ≥ 10,000 (DIN EN 12086) |
| Thermal Conductivity ($\lambda$) | ≤ 0.034 W/(m·K) at 0℃ |
| Fire Safety Classification | Class 0 / Class 1 (BS 476 Part 6/7), Class V-0 (UL94), self-extinguishing |
| Property / Dimension | Standard Specification Range |
|---|---|
| Wall Thickness Range | 9mm, 13mm, 19mm, 25mm, 32mm, 40mm |
| Inner Diameter (ID) Range | 6mm to 114mm (compatible with global copper and steel tube sizes) |
| Length Specifications | Standard 1.83 meters (6 feet) or 2.0 meters per section |
| Surface Processing | Evenly-sprayed micro-textured skin for anti-abrasion and smooth pulling |
